Acting for Stage & Screen | Grades 9th–12th

Ready to become a more versatile performer? This twice-weekly acting class gives high school actors the opportunity to train in both live theatre and on-camera performance, developing the skills needed to succeed in any acting environment.

Mondays: Acting for Stage with Director Justin Pike

Students will focus on the techniques required for theatrical performance, including voice and diction, physical storytelling, character development, scene study, script analysis, and stage presence. Actors will learn how to make bold choices, connect with scene partners, and bring stories to life for a live audience.

Wednesdays: Acting for Screen with Casting Director & Tv/Film Actor Warren McCullough

Students will explore the unique demands of film and television acting, including on-camera technique, audition skills, continuity, subtle emotional work, framing, and acting for close-ups. Through recorded exercises and scene work, actors will learn how to create authentic performances that translate effectively on screen.

Throughout the year, students will build confidence, strengthen their acting toolkit, and gain experience adapting their performances to different mediums. This class is ideal for dedicated actors looking to deepen their craft, prepare for auditions, and develop the flexibility needed in today’s performing arts industry.
